Fourth candidate emerges in constituency
'Strong, professional, hardworking leadership - not self-gratification of the individuals elected'.
That's what new candidate for Middle, 58-year-old businessman William Bowers, believes is needed following the General Election in September.
Mr Bowers will run against the current sitting member Howard Quayle, ex-bank manager Bill Shimmins, and former education official Paul Craine.
He says government finances need addressing as soon as possible - as the new administration shapes the path forward.
